Press Release Wednesday, October 31, 2012Guns and Hoses Blood Drive Results
On Tuesday October 30, 2012, the Bryan Police Department and the Bryan Fire Department worked with the Blood Center of the Brazos Valley for the Guns and Hoses Blood Drive. The blood drive is a friendly competition between the two city departments to see who could raise the most donations for the local blood bank. This effort was supported by the Chiefs from the Police and Fire Department. The blood drive was hosted at City Hall and ran from 8:00 am to 3:00 pm. We had officers, fire fighters, city employees, family members of employees, and citizens donate their time and blood for this event. The Police Department retains their title by receiving the most donations this year. We would like to thank all those who participated. The purpose of the competition was to give back to the community and to educate the public of the importance of giving blood. Each blood unit given can save up to three lives. The blood raised in this blood drive will benefit those who need it.
